The Importance of Sustainable Fashion
The fashion industry is notorious for its negative impact on the environment, from excessive waste and pollution to exploitative labor practices. Sustainable fashion seeks to change this narrative by opting for eco-friendly materials, ethical labor practices, and transparency throughout the supply chain. Brands that prioritize sustainability not only contribute positively to the planet, but they also resonate with consumers who prefer to make responsible purchasing decisions.
Key Aspects of Sustainable Dress Manufacturing
- Materials: Sustainable fashion brands often use organic, recycled, or upcycled materials that minimize environmental impact.
- Production Processes: Many ethical manufacturers focus on reducing water and energy consumption in their production processes.
- Labor Practices: Ensuring fair wages and safe working conditions is crucial for sustainable fashion brands.
- Transparency: Many sustainable brands maintain an open dialogue about their supply chain and production methods.
Spotlight on Leading Sustainable Dress Manufacturers
Many manufacturers are making strides in the sustainability realm. Here are a few notable names to watch:
1. Reformation
Reformation focuses on creating stylish clothing while keeping the environmental footprint low. The brand uses sustainable materials and offers transparency about its practices, allowing consumers to make informed choices.
2. Amour Vert
Known for their chic styles, Amour Vert produces its clothing in the USA and uses eco-friendly fabrics. They also plant a tree for every tee sold, contributing to reforestation efforts.
3. Eileen Fisher
Eileen Fisher has long been a pioneer in sustainable fashion, focusing on organic, recycled, and renewable materials while also committing to fair labor practices across its supply chain.

FAQs
1. What is sustainable fashion?
Sustainable fashion refers to clothing that is produced in a way that is environmentally friendly and socially responsible. This includes using eco-friendly materials, ensuring fair labor practices, and minimizing waste and pollution.
2. Why is it important to support sustainable brands?
Supporting sustainable brands helps reduce the negative impact of traditional fashion on the environment and communities. It encourages ethical practices and helps promote a healthier planet and society.
3. How can I identify sustainable brands?
Look for certifications like BSCI, SEDEX, and WRAP, which indicate the brand’s commitment to ethical practices. Additionally, many sustainable brands openly share their supply chain practices and materials used on their websites.
4. Is sustainable fashion more expensive?
While sustainable fashion can sometimes be more expensive due to higher quality materials and ethical production processes, many consumers find value in the longer lifespan of these garments compared to fast fashion alternatives.
5. How can I contribute to sustainable fashion?
You can contribute by choosing to purchase from sustainable brands, recycling or donating old clothing, and being mindful of your fashion consumption habits.
